【什么叫节点】在计算机科学、网络技术以及系统架构中,“节点”是一个非常常见的术语。它通常用来描述一个连接点或一个独立的单元,可以是硬件设备、软件组件或数据流中的一个位置。理解“节点”的含义对于学习网络结构、分布式系统、区块链等技术至关重要。
一、什么是节点?
节点(Node) 是指在一个系统、网络或图结构中,具有特定功能或作用的独立单元。它可以是物理设备,如计算机、路由器、交换机;也可以是逻辑上的单位,如数据库中的记录、程序中的函数、区块链中的区块等。
简单来说,节点就是系统中能够独立运行、通信或处理信息的基本单元。
二、节点的常见类型
类型 | 说明 | 示例 |
物理节点 | 硬件设备,可直接参与数据传输或计算 | 路由器、服务器、个人电脑 |
逻辑节点 | 软件或程序中定义的单元 | 数据库中的表、程序中的类、API接口 |
网络节点 | 在网络中承担数据转发或接收功能的设备 | 交换机、网关、中继器 |
区块链节点 | 参与区块链网络维护和验证的设备 | 区块链矿工节点、全节点、轻节点 |
图论中的节点 | 图结构中的基本元素,表示对象或实体 | 社交网络中的用户、地图中的地点 |
三、节点的作用
1. 连接与通信:在网络中,节点负责数据的发送和接收。
2. 数据处理:某些节点具备计算能力,可以对数据进行处理。
3. 存储功能:部分节点用于存储数据,如服务器、数据库节点。
4. 控制与管理:一些节点负责系统的监控、调度和管理任务。
5. 分布式协作:在分布式系统中,多个节点协同工作完成任务。
四、节点的应用场景
- 互联网:每个设备都是一个节点,构成庞大的网络。
- 区块链:所有参与共识机制的设备都是节点。
- 云计算:数据中心中的服务器作为计算节点。
- 物联网(IoT):传感器、智能设备作为终端节点。
- 社交网络:用户、账号、内容都可以视为节点。
五、总结
“节点”是一个广泛使用的概念,其核心在于表示系统中的一个独立单元。根据不同的应用场景,节点可以是物理设备、逻辑单元或网络中的连接点。理解节点的概念有助于更好地分析和设计复杂的系统结构。
关键词 | 含义 |
节点 | 系统中独立运行、通信或处理信息的单元 |
物理节点 | 实体设备,如服务器、路由器 |
逻辑节点 | 软件或程序中的抽象单元 |
网络节点 | 执行数据传输的设备 |
区块链节点 | 参与区块链网络的设备 |
应用场景 | 互联网、区块链、云计算、物联网等 |
通过以上内容可以看出,“节点”不仅是技术术语,更是构建现代数字世界的重要基础。
以上就是【什么叫节点】相关内容,希望对您有所帮助。